An Update on the Sabres Coaching Search

The NHL playoffs are in full swing. As for the Buffalo Sabres, they are trying to turn things around. The team has missed the playoffs for a tenth consecutive season and are in the market for a new head coach. According to TSN insider Pierre LeBrun, the team might be one step closer to hiring their next head coach.

As you can see from the tweet above, general manager Kevyn Adams has interviews scheduled with Rick Tocchet, Bruce Boudreau and more candidates. LeBrun also said Adams is in no rush and that interim head coach Don Granato also remains in the mix. I love this from Adams, there’s no need to rush. Adams needs to take his time to make sure he has the right guy. Starting with Granato, I wouldn’t mind keeping him around. He doesn’t have that much experience but the team did play better under him after the firing of former head coach Ralph Krueger. I still would like to have a coach who has a lot of experience but I would be okay with the Sabres keeping Granato around.

As for Bruce Boudreau, I want him coaching the Sabres next season. He has everything the Sabres are looking for. Experience, a good playoff record and coached a team that won the Stanley Cup. According to Hockey Reference, his coaching record for the regular season is 567-302-115. When it comes to the postseason, he has a record of 43-47. He would be a great hire for Buffalo and I think he can help the franchise turn this ship around.

The other candidate listed was Rick Tocchet. I’m not high on Tocchet to be honest. His coaching record during the regular season is 178-200-60 and his postseason record is 4-5 according to Hockey Reference. I know I don’t have a say in the coaching search but I don’t think Adams should hire Tocchet. His coaching record isn’t really that impressive and he doesn’t have that much experience compared to Boudreau. It’s just my opinion but I don’t think Tocchet would be the right man for the job.
